What Is the Cost of Living Near Burlington?

Understanding the cost of living near Burlington is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Howardcenter.
Burlington's Cost of Living Index is approximately 118.5 (18.5% more expensive than US average; 11.7% more than VT average). Largest VT city (UVM), desirable, Lake Champlain, high housing costs.
